[0025] see Figure 1 to Figure 8 , the present invention, that is, a bolt assembly process for the evaporator sealing cover in the hydrostatic test, the bolt 1 includes a head (not shown in the figure) and a screw rod, the screw rod includes a cylindrical outer thread 11 and a set A mandrel 12 in the casing 11 and connected at one end to the head. The assembly process of the present invention comprises the following steps,
[0026] The calculation step is to determine the bolt pre-tightening force F required by the bolt 1 according to the stress of the bolt 1 in the hydraulic test, and calculate the corresponding different bolt pre-tightening forces F according to the formula F=k*(Δl)+y The remaining elongation Δl, where k is a coefficient (determined according to the material and structure of the bolt 1), y is a correction value; according ...
